Summary (tl;dr)
A body believed to be that of 19-year-old Camila Mendoza Olmos, who went missing from her San Antonio home on Christmas Eve, was discovered near her residence after an extensive search, with authorities indicating no foul play and signs of self-harm.
Essential Background
Camila Mendoza Olmos, a 19-year-old Northwest Vista College student, was last seen on the morning of December 24, 2025, leaving her home on the 11000 block of Caspian Spring in San Antonio, Texas. Her mother reported her missing when she didn't return from what was believed to be a morning walk, and it was noted as unusual that she left her phone at home. The Bexar County Sheriff's Office issued a CLEAR Alert, and a widespread search involving law enforcement and volunteers commenced. Authorities also released dashcam footage believed to show her walking along Wildhorse Parkway shortly after her disappearance. Concerns for her mental health were raised, and investigators confirmed a history of depression and suicidal thoughts.
The Full Story
On December 30, 2025, a body was discovered in a field approximately 100 yards from Camila Mendoza Olmos's home in San Antonio, Texas. Although formal identification is pending, the clothing on the body matched descriptions of what Mendoza Olmos was wearing when she was last seen. Bexar County Sheriff Javier Salazar stated that foul play is not suspected, and there were indications of self-harm. A firearm, which was believed to be a family member's missing weapon, was also found near the body, though it has not yet been confirmed if it is the same weapon. The area where the body was found had been previously searched but was re-examined due to concerns over tall grass.
